반응형
// row, column 에 해당하는 text 가져오기
m_ctrlList.GetItemText(RowIndex, ColumnIndex)
// 현재 출력된 list 갯수 가져오기
m_ctrlList.GetItemCount()
// 초기화 : 3개의 Column 이 있을때..
LV_COLUMN lvColumn;
char* list[3] = {"고 객 명", "계 좌 번 호", "계 좌 정 보"};
int nWidth[3] = {80, 80, 320};
for(int i=0; i < 3; i++)
{
lvColumn.mask = LVCF_FMT | LVCF_SUBITEM | LVCF_TEXT | LVCF_WIDTH;
lvColumn.fmt = LVCFMT_LEFT; // 왼쪽 정렬
lvColumn.pszText = list[i];
lvColumn.iSubItem = i;
lvColumn.cx = nWidth[i];
m_ctrlList.InsertColumn(i, &lvColumn);
}
// 추가하기
LV_ITEM lvItem;
lvItem.mask = LVIF_TEXT | LVIF_IMAGE;
lvItem.iItem = nItem; // Row
lvItem.iSubItem = 0; // Column
lvItem.pszText = (LPSTR)(LPCTSTR) String;
m_ctrlList.InsertItem(&lvItem);
m_ctrlList.SetItemText(nItem, nSubItem, (LPCTSTR)str);
반응형
'프로그래밍 > MFC' 카테고리의 다른 글
srand(), rand() 함수 설명 (0) | 2009.02.11 |
---|---|
CString, Int, Double 변수들 변환 (0) | 2009.02.11 |
Dialog 에 관련된 것들.. (0) | 2009.02.11 |
콤보박스에 관련된 것들.. (0) | 2009.02.11 |
리스트 컨트롤 격자보이기 (0) | 2009.02.11 |